What is a Business Proposal?

At its core‚ a business proposal is a written offer from a seller to a prospective buyer. It outlines the scope of work‚ the pricing structure‚ the timeline‚ and the specific value proposition that sets your solution apart from the competition. Unlike a business plan‚ which is internal‚ a proposal is an external-facing document meant to solve a specific problem or fulfill a requirement for your client.

Types of Proposals

Understanding the context is key. Proposals generally fall into three categories:

  • Solicited Proposals: These are written in response to a Request for Proposal (RFP). The client has already defined their needs‚ and you are bidding to meet them.
  • Unsolicited Proposals: These are essentially “cold calls” in document form. You identify a potential client’s pain point and propose a solution before they have formally asked for one.
  • Informal Proposals: Often used for smaller projects or existing relationships‚ these are more conversational and less rigid in structure.

Key Elements of a Winning Proposal

To craft a professional document‚ you must include several non-negotiable components:

  1. Executive Summary: The hook. Summarize the client’s problem and how your specific solution will solve it.
  2. Problem Statement: Demonstrate that you truly understand the client’s needs. Show them you have listened.
  3. Proposed Solution: Detail your approach‚ the methodology you will use‚ and the specific deliverables expected.
  4. Qualifications: Why you? Highlight your team’s experience‚ case studies‚ or certifications that prove your credibility.
  5. Timeline and Pricing: Be transparent. Provide a clear roadmap of milestones and a breakdown of costs to build trust.
  6. Terms and Conditions: Legally define the scope‚ payment schedules‚ and project boundaries to avoid future conflict.

The Step-by-Step Writing Process

Start by researching the client deeply. The more you know about their industry challenges‚ the better you can tailor your language. Once you have gathered your data‚ use a professional template to maintain consistency. Do not let the formatting distract from your core message; keep the design clean and readable.

After drafting‚ review the content with a critical eye. Does it answer the “Why us?” question? Is the pricing competitive yet reflective of your value? Using artificial intelligence tools can help refine your tone‚ but always ensure the final polish is uniquely yours. Before hitting submit‚ run through a checklist: check for grammatical errors‚ ensure all contact details are correct‚ and verify that the call to action is clear.

Closing the Deal

The goal of the proposal is to lead the client to a signature. Once submitted‚ don’t just wait. Follow up professionally within a reasonable timeframe. If you are rejected‚ ask for feedback—this is invaluable data that will help you improve your future proposals.
